Promising drug tested for childhood brain cancer relapse
Disease control TerminatedThis study looked at a drug called CX-4945 for children whose SHH medulloblastoma (a type of brain tumor) had come back. It involved 21 participants and aimed to find the safest dose and see if the drug could shrink tumors. The study was stopped early, so results are limited.
